Mental Illness Defined

Mental illness is disease, dysfunction, or disruption of the brain, leading to negative thoughts and behaviors. There are multiple types of mental illness and each can impact a person differently.

Types of Mental Health Providers in Hiawassee, GA

A mental illness can manifest itself in a number of ways, (negative or irrational thoughts, physical ailments, problematic behaviors) and the intensity can range from mild to severe. To address the wide spectrum of mental illnesses, there are different care providers who can provide various types of treatment. Let’s consider each option:

Psychologists in Hiawassee

A psychologist is a mental health professional who is trained to conduct psychological evaluations and make diagnoses. These individuals are highly adept at helping individuals understand and cope with their feelings and thoughts, and usually do so through talk therapy in an individual or group setting. Much of their practice revolves around addressing and resolving dest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.

Psychiatrists in Hiawassee

Psychiatrists are medical doctors (M.D) who have received psychiatric training. The main difference between psychologists and psychiatrists is that psychiatrists are able to prescribe medications. As such, psychiatrists are commonly sought after to help address chronic disorders or serious mental illness (SMI), conditions that require medical treatment. Despite the fact that they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), some psychiatrists choose not to.

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in Hiawassee

All are interchangeable terms used to describe mental health care professionals who have completed a master degree in in a field related to mental or public health. As they are not physicians, they tend to treat mental health issues with approaches similar to psychologists. More often than not, talk therapy is the primary mode of treatment offered.

Paying for Hiawassee Mental Health Treatment

In reference to paying for mental health rehab, most individuals will have a few different options depending on financial circumstances. As mentioned previously, contacting your insurance provider is wise. They can direct you to in-network mental health rehabs. Option 2 is out-of-pocket payment. This is a typical option for those who choose a mental health rehab not covered by their insurance, or in the absence of healthcare coverage. Option 3 is seeking treatment at a state-funded mental health facility. This is another option for people who are uninsured or have limited financial means.
